Lower Makefield Township is a township in Bucks County, Pennsylvania, U.S., and is usually referred to as Yardley, due to the prominence of Yardley Borough in that area. However, Yardley Borough is much smaller by both population and land area, and is surrounded by Lower Makefield on three sides (the fourth side being the Delaware River). Lower Makefield Township has been a top finisher in the MONEY Magazine and CNN/Money Best Places to Live rankings for the Eastern region of the United States in the under 100,000 population category.
